In the July Twilight Talk, Matt Jones from Bristol City Council shares his team’s ‘warts and all’ experiences with installations of heat pumps in social housing and walks through a series of resources the team has created to tackle the issues they have come across.
Matt has led the City Council’s work on heat pump quality assurance, collaborating with partners including Nesta and the University of Bristol to systematically review and redesign the organisation’s approach. This work is grounded in practical experience, drawing on insights from the delivery and review of nearly 100 inhome heat pump installation audits across Bristol. The programme has helped identify recurring technical, design and consumerexperience issues and translate them into actionable changes to specifications, procurement, installer engagement and homeowner support, contributing to higherquality installations and improved confidence in heat pump deployment at scale.
